ME AI Message, May 27 (UTC+8): AI model aggregation platform OpenRouter announced the completion of a $1.13 billion Series B round led by CapitalG, the growth fund under Google’s parent company, with participation from a16z, Menlo Ventures, NVentures (NVIDIA’s investment arm), and the venture arms of ServiceNow, MongoDB, Snowflake, and Databricks. The company’s valuation has exceeded $1 billion. OpenRouter stated that over the past six months, weekly platform usage has increased from 5 trillion tokens to 25 trillion tokens, reflecting a rapid acceleration of AI applications from experimental phases into production environments.(Source: X platform)
